Peabody (BTU) CFO Mark Spurbeck Receives Award, Sells Shares

What Happened
Mark Spurbeck, EVP and CFO of Peabody Energy (BTU), had 17,136 performance-based shares vest on Feb 18, 2026 (awarded/acquired at $0.00). To cover tax obligations on the vesting, 7,549 shares were withheld/disposed at $33.29 each, netting approximately $251,306.

Key Details

  • Transaction dates: Feb 18, 2026 (reported on Form 4 filed Feb 20, 2026).
  • Award/acquisition: 17,136 shares @ $0.00 (code A).
  • Tax withholding/disposition: 7,549 shares @ $33.29, total ~$251,306 (code F).
  • Shares owned after transaction: Not specified in the provided filing.
  • Footnotes: F1 — These shares were earned from a Jan 3, 2023 performance stock unit grant after a multi-year performance/vesting period; Compensation Committee certified performance on Feb 18, 2026. F2 — 7,549 shares were withheld to satisfy tax withholding upon vesting.
  • Filing timeliness: Filed Feb 20 for a Feb 18 transaction; no late filing indicated.

Context
This was a vesting of performance stock units (an award), not an open-market buy or a voluntary sale. The 7,549-share disposition was a standard tax-withholding/cashless step upon vesting, not necessarily an indicator of broader insider sentiment.
